Tests pass fine with htmltidy but one test fail with tidy-html5. Can anyone else reproduce this?
Comment 4 Bruce Schultz 2019-12-03 12:24:09 UTC
I can confirm the test failure with tidy-html5. I've reported it upstream: https://github.com/countergram/pytidylib/issues/29

I've had pytidylib installed from a local overlay with the dependencies modified to work with either htmltidy or tidy-html5 with this:

RDEPEND="|| ( app-text/tidy-html5 app-text/htmltidy )

Would it be feasible to get such a change into gentoo, perhaps with the order reversed so that htmltidy would be installed by default, but it could still be swapped easily?
Comment 5 Marek Szuba archtester gentoo-dev 2021-08-27 10:44:55 UTC
monsieurp and I have decided that since HTACG Tidy is the official successor of W3C Tidy rather than just a fork (see the 2015-01-25 news item on http://tidy.sourceforge.net/), we will merge html5-tidy into htmltidy. Therefore, it an alternative in RDEPEND is no longer needed.

BTW. tidylib passes all tests against the latest version of HTACG Tidy, available in the tree as app-text/htmltidy-5.8.0-r1.
